  13. The door stop is not milled as part of the frame (unless your house is over 75 years old). If you can take the door off the hinges and CAREFULLY remove the door stop you will be able to just squeeze through the door with the stand. Once inside, just use trim nails to put the door stop back on, caulk it and paint it to match just like it was. Have had to do this twice to move a freezer in/out of my house. And have had to do it for several clients who bought items that were *just* a little too big to get through the door.

  24. If you value your tank (and your sanity) get them out now.Take out the rock they are on and sun dry it for a LONG time. The vinegar treatment only makes them mad, and they just split and multiply (same for aiptasia). I bought a frag with them on it, I wound up tearing half my tank out to get rid of them. They can, and will, take over your tank and kill your corals. You say they are only on one rock, get that rock out now, or regret it for a long time.
